The Records and Information Management (RIM) Project Manager will be responsible for leading and overseeing a multidisciplinary team providing records and information management (RIM) and related support services. The Project Manager will demonstrate strong leadership, exceptional project management capabilities, and a solid understanding of federal records management policies and programs. The selected candidate will oversee deliverables across functional areas such as FOIA, FACA, controlled correspondence, forms development, AEM development, and records retention.
The Project Manager will also be expected to maintain an open, collaborative mindset and demonstrate a willingness to contribute subject matter expertise to support corporate growth initiatives.
- Contract and Project Leadership:
Serve as the primary point of contact for all contract management-related matters; coordinate the submission of monthly status reports, personnel support reports, and briefing materials; respond proactively to inquiries, risks, or concerns raised by internal or external stakeholders; assist corporate staff with strategic insight, lessons learned, or data to support future planning and potential initiatives. - Business Functional Oversight:
Ensure integration and consistency across functional areas to maintain operational cohesion. - Records Management Support:
Ensure compliance with NARA guidelines and effective management; lead initiatives to improve records lifecycle processes, file plan consolidation, and agency-wide readiness; oversee FOIA-related business processes, ensuring accuracy in reporting and knowledge management systems. - Forms Support and AEM Development:
Provide strategic oversight of Adobe PDF form development and maintenance; coordinate requirement gathering, user acceptance testing (UAT), and ensure Section 508 accessibility compliance. - Strategic Contributions:
Contribute expertise in solution building and business case analysis that support evolving client needs; collaborate with corporate leadership by sharing operational insights that may support business development or strategic growth opportunities.
- 5+ years of experience managing federal government projects, including RIM or related areas.
- Bachelor's degree in Business, Public Administration, Information Systems, or related field.
- PMP or other relevant project management certification.
- Strong understanding of federal records requirements including NARA guidelines, FOIA, FACA, and related compliance.
- Proven experience managing cross-functional teams and large-scale project engagements.
- Demonstrated success using collaboration tools such as Microsoft Teams, SharePoint Online, Adobe AEM, ASANA.
- Excellent communication, facilitation, and stakeholder engagement skills.
- Strong analytical, problem-solving, and documentation capabilities.
- Familiarity with Section 508 compliance and WCAG accessibility standards.
Must be able to obtain a Public Trust clearance. US Citizenship is a requirement for a Public Trust clearance at this location.
